Q: I went to switch a load of laundry to the dryer, and my garments are getting moist! Why did not the washerman drain the water? Ought to I name a repairman?

a: Not now. In case your washer will not spin, it would possibly Signifies a malfunction that requires a repairman, however usually a easy DIY repair can get your washer working as soon as once more. Learn on to find out the reason for your washer woes and which of them you may remedy with out skilled assist. Be aware that a few of these repairs might require you to take away the again of the washer to test inner parts; This needs to be carried out solely after the machine is unplugged and the water supply is turned off.

Redistribute an off-balanced load of laundry.

An unbalanced load of laundry is without doubt one of the most typical causes of an inadequate spin cycle. Generally garments can sit on one aspect of the drum, inflicting the washer to decelerate. (This occurs most frequently when washing giant and heavy gadgets like comforters or heavy coats.) Additionally, some newer machines will not attain excessive sufficient speeds with off-balanced hundreds, leaving garments soggy. If you happen to suspect a distribution drawback, strive rearranging your moist laundry and operating the spin cycle once more.

Flatten an off-kilter washer.

Your washer won’t spin correctly whether it is located inconsistently on its adjustable pedestal. Look ahead to different indicators of an unlevel machine — extreme noise and vibration throughout the wash course of — and, in the event that they verify your suspicions, alter every leg up or down till the washer is totally stage.

Examine energy supply.

Whereas it might seem to be a no brainer, double test that the washer is plugged in. A mid-cycle bump or jolt may cause the plug to come out of the outlet, and a re-plug can put you again in. in enterprise. If the facility wire is safe within the outlet, test your house’s circuit panel to ensure the breaker did not journey.

Cease utilizing extension cords.

Your washer’s heavy-duty energy wire needs to be plugged immediately into an outlet—not an extension wire. Many extensions might not conduct sufficient electrical energy to run the door washer’s motor, which can then overheat and shut itself down. The washer will in all probability work once more after the motor cools down, however the issue is prone to reoccur. Plus, counting on an extension wire will shorten the helpful lifetime of the washer. If you cannot transfer the washer nearer to the outlet, wire a brand new outlet inside an inexpensive distance.

Examine the spin change.

In top-loading washers, a small protrusion on the underside of the lid depresses a change when the lid is closed, which serves as a security precaution to detect when the lid is closed. If the protrusion is bent out of practice, it might not set off the change as meant.

Take a look at the speculation by opening the lid, choosing the spin cycle in your washer, after which manually miserable the change with one finger. If the machine begins to spin usually, merely fold the protrusion again in order that it correctly engages the spin change.

Did your washer not spin once you manually pressed the change? The issue might stem from a fault within the change itself. Happily, changing a damaged spin change could be a DIY-friendly challenge, relying on the washer model and mannequin. Seek the advice of your proprietor’s handbook for directions.

Keep on with high-efficiency detergent with a front-load washer.

You could not understand it, however most front-loading washers require high-efficiency (HE) detergent with low foaming motion. In any other case, non-HE detergents can produce a lot suds that the machine’s sensors detect the washer as too full. Because of this, the washer will not attain sufficient spin pace, leaving your garments dripping on the finish of the cycle.

Undo any kinks within the hose.

This may impede the stream of water out of the equipment, leading to a washer that begins the spin cycle however by no means picks up pace and doesn’t drain the water. Take the washer out to look behind it and test that the hose is freed from kinks, then fastidiously push the machine again into place so you do not inadvertently bend the hose once more.

Observe down blockages within the drainage system.

Small objects — corresponding to pennies, keys, buttons, or clothes clips — can fall out of pockets and onto clothes, then lodge themselves within the hoses that join the washer to the drain pump. Finally, blocked drainage prevents the machine from rotating.

In some washers, the drain pump (often positioned on the again of the washer, close to the ground) may be accessed with out eradicating the again of the washer, whereas different fashions require you to take the washer again aside. Seek the advice of your proprietor’s handbook for model-specific directions. Then take away the clamps that maintain the hoses in place, clear any blockages you discover, and reconnect the hoses.

Substitute or alter the drive belt.

A damaged drive belt, or one which has slipped off the pulley wheel, can agitate the washer throughout the wash cycle and but – regardless of the noise of the motor operating – the drum stays stationary throughout the spin cycle. To find out if so, take away the again of the washer and test to see if the belt continues to be on the pulley. If not, you could want to interchange the drive belt. Be sure you purchase one made particularly on your model and mannequin of washer.

If nonetheless caught, name within the professionals.

Further experience is required when it comes time to deal with the next causes:

  • drain pump Might be responsible when water will not drain out. If you understand how to make use of a multimeter, you may carry out continuity checks on the drain pump’s motor connections to see if they’re nonetheless viable. Nonetheless, so far as DIY work goes; Non-working drain pumps will must be changed by a repairman.
  • to find out whether or not motor coupler (a small rubber and plastic connector piece positioned between the washer’s motor and its transmission) is damaged, do this easy take a look at: Set the dial in your washer to the wash cycle and switch it on, permitting the drum to fill with water. . When the water reaches the fill stage, agitation ought to start. If you happen to hear the motor kick in however the heart agitator doesn’t transfer, your machine wants a brand new coupler. Whereas a alternative is within the ballpark of a mere $20, this repair is ​​DIY-friendly just for these expert in small motor repairs.
  • a Motor Regardless of a great connection to the facility supply and breaker, one that does not go on in any respect can stop the washer from spinning. Some motors have carbon brushes that put on out over time, and they are often changed cheaply. Nonetheless, the issue could also be extra widespread than a worn carbon brush, and it is inconceivable to know for certain with out eradicating the motor and testing it. Even with the washer unplugged, induction-type motors that comprise capacitors may give you a major electrical shock, so motor testing and restore is greatest left to professionals.
  • some washers characteristic Electro-mechanical transmission shifters or clutch Which when worn may cause leakage within the washer. This problem additionally requires consideration from a repairman.
